R&D: 2026 Nuffield Scholar Yumeng Chen


Listen Later

Yumeng Chen is one of the 2026 Nuffield Scholars who has been sponsored by Hort Innovation.

Her project will explore how virtual modelling can optimise production systems and decision-making in vegetable growing. As she describes it the project will look at ways of using a virtual model of part of a farm, or part of an operation’s supply chain, combined with historical sales and production data, to forecast what will be needed in the year ahead.

Yumeng is a Senior Account Manager with Fragapane Farms, which grows lettuce, broccoli, cauliflower, celery and other green vegetable crops near Werribee in Victoria.

She’s responsible for the  domestic retailers and the export markets, but is also involved in projects related to supply planning, demand forecasting and data analytics.
